High Power Diodes Simple high voltage power supply?
Using just transformers, capacitors and diodes available at radioshack. Any help please. Need to be 1kv-10kv. New to electronics, trying to figure this out, small budget.
Get the highest voltage transformer you can get. Then get diodes rated at least 3x that voltage, and caps equal to 1.5x that voltage.
You can use a voltage multiplier to step the voltage up further if needed.
If you have a 5KV transformer, one diode and cap will get you about 7000 volts DC or a bit less. Adding additional diodes and caps will get you an addtionall 7kv for each.
circuits at http://www.play-hookey.com/ac_theory/ps_v_multipliers.html
Now all the above is for low current. It you need substantial amounts of current, then different techniques must be used.
High Quality Content by WIKIPEDIA articles The Diodes were a Canadian punk/new wave band formed in 1976. They released five albums: Diodes (1977), Released (1979), ActionReaction (1980), Survivors (1982), and Time/Damage Live 1978 (2010). One of the first Toronto bands playing that style of music, The Diodes helped foster the scene in the city. Along with manager Ralph Alfonso, The Diodes opened the first Canadian punk nightclub in 1977, called Crash n Burn, where many of the citys punk bands at that time played. The first band to play the club was The Nerves, on a double bill with The Diodes. The club was closed at the end of the summer of 1977 due to complaints by the Liberal Party of Ontario (the principal tenants of the building). Lighting is essential to modern society but it accounts for nearly 20 of the electrical energy usage. Thus efforts to increase the conversion efficiencies of light sources are attracting more and more attention. Potential high efficiency light sources are fluorescent lamps or lightemitting diodes (LEDs). Modern LEDs show internal quantum efficiencies of virtually 100 . However, in the case of standard LEDs most of this light is trapped inside the device because of total internal reflection at the interface semiconductorair. Several methods have been developed in order to increase the extraction efficiency. This can be done either by optimizing the device geometry in order to increase the escape cone or by incorporating a resonant structure in order to force the internal emission into the existing escape cone. The latter approach is called microcavity LED (MCLED) or resonant cavity LED (RCLED) and is presented in detail in this work. Novel concepts to further increase the external quantum efficiency are discussed and experimental results are presented. Light photons impinging upon a semiconductor material in the vicinity of a P-N junction release conduction carriers to produce current flow through the photodiode effect. Photodiode amplifiers convert this current to a voltage in a relationship that remains linear as long as the amplifier eliminates signal voltage swing from the photodiode...

what could cause a Schottky diode forward V drop too high (>2V with Vin~15V)?
The situation was that when measuring a Schottky diode along, the forward V drop was normal. While mounting the same device on a test board (a power supply), the forward V drop ~2V.
normally the Vf is specified for a specific pass or bias current. what in your test setup did you use to set the current through the device? at higher than normal junction temperature, the Vf will increase. without any heat sinking, the junction temperature responds to the pass current and that may have been the issue with your test proceedure. a very hot diode.
